Output 74f57b7a205e8b77e27a24a424a3a8b6b58c6a34c12bcf7bc45324c13f3f2222:886

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71b1bc7875d3227c0f10f5cfb1a2e8e23f9b16cf64c4ae8d67013a17a829771f
address
tb1pwxcmc7r46v38crcs7h8mrghguglek9k0vnz2art8qyap02pfwu0s8688pd
transaction
74f57b7a205e8b77e27a24a424a3a8b6b58c6a34c12bcf7bc45324c13f3f2222